Konwerter eBooków
Sheetize eBook Converter dla .NET umożliwia bezprzewodową konwersję dokumentów do i z popularnych formatów eBooks, takich jak EPUB i MOBI. Jest idealny dla wydawców, bibliotek cyfrowych i deweloperów, którzy integrują funkcjonalność ebook w swoich aplikacjach.
Główne cechy
PDF do EPUB Konwersja
Łatwo przekonwertować pliki PDF do formatu EPUB, optymalizując je dla eReaders i innych urządzeń obsługujących formaty eBook.
EPUB do konwersji PDF
Konwertuj treść eBook z EPUB do PDF, dzięki czemu nadaje się do drukowania lub przeglądania offline w standardowym formacie.
Szczegółowy przewodnik
Konwersja PDF do EPUB
Aby przekonwertować dokument PDF na eBook EPUB:
- Inicjalizuj konwerter : Stwórz instancję
EbookConverter
. - Zestaw opcji konwersji : Użyj
PdfToEpubOptions
Aby skonfigurować ustawienia do wyjścia EPUB, takie jak obsługa obrazu i metadane. - Wyznacz wejście i wyjście Paths : ustaw ścieżki dla wejściu PDF oraz wyjścia EPUB.
- Wykonaj konwersję : zadzwoń do
Process
Metoda konwersji dokumentu.
Przykład: Konwersja PDF do EPUB
// Step 1: Initialize the eBook Converter
var converter = new EbookConverter();
// Step 2: Configure options for PDF to EPUB conversion
var options = new PdfToEpubOptions();
options.IncludeImages = true; // Include images in the output EPUB
options.SetMetadata("Title", "Converted eBook");
// Step 3: Set file paths
options.AddInput(new FileDataSource("input.pdf"));
options.AddOutput(new FileDataSource("output.epub"));
// Step 4: Run the conversion
converter.Process(options);
Dostępne opcje konwersji PDF do EPUB
- IncludeImages : Wyznacz, czy należy włączyć obrazy z oryginalnego PDF w wynikającym EPUB.
- SetMetadata : Dodaj metadane, takie jak tytuł, autor i podmiot do pliku EPUB.
Konwersja EPUB do PDF
Aby przekonwertować plik EPUB do PDF:
- Inicjalizuj konwerter : Stwórz instancję
EbookConverter
. - Konfiguruj opcje PDF : Użyj
EpubToPdfOptions
Określenie ustawień, takich jak layout strony i margines. - Wyznacz ścieżki : ustaw wejście EPUB i wyjście PDF płyta.
- Wykonaj konwersję : zadzwoń do
Process
Metoda zakończenia konwersji.
Przykład: Konwersja EPUB do PDF
// Step 1: Initialize the eBook Converter
var converter = new EbookConverter();
// Step 2: Configure options for EPUB to PDF conversion
var options = new EpubToPdfOptions();
options.PageLayoutOption = PageLayoutOption.Portrait;
options.Margin = new MarginSettings(10, 10, 10, 10);
// Step 3: Set file paths
options.AddInput(new FileDataSource("input.epub"));
options.AddOutput(new FileDataSource("output.pdf"));
// Step 4: Execute the conversion
converter.Process(options);
Dodatkowe opcje dla EPUB do konwersji PDF
- PageLayoutOption : Ustaw rozkład strony dla wynikającego pliku PDF, np.
Portrait
lubLandscape
. - MarginSettings : Określ margines dla wyjścia PDF.
Konwerter ten jest bardzo przydatny zarówno dla wydawców, jak i deweloperów, którzy potrzebują automatyzacji przepływów roboczych związanych z eBook. Niezależnie od tego, czy tworzymy eBooks z dokumentów PDF czy przygotowujemy pliki ebook do drukowania, Sheetize e Book Converter zapewnia elastyczne rozwiązanie.